F1 will consult with drivers over future pre-race shows plans after Miami's attempt drew frosty criticism. Story:

Amid pomp and ceremony in the build-up to the Miami GP, the entire grid was introduced by American rapper LL Cool J in front of an orchestra, cheerleaders and dry ice.

However, it is understood that there was broad agreement to try it for this weekend in Miami and see how the format can be tweaked. And while criticisms of the event gained traction after the Miami race, a number of drivers felt it was actually a good step.said: “I think it is cool that the sport is continuously growing and evolving and not just doing the same stuff that they’ve done in the past. They are trying new things; they are trying to improve the show and I am in full support of it.
